Duties and Responsibilities:


AUM Office of Sponsored Programs and Research, at Auburn University at Montgomery is seeking a full-time Grant Writer. Reporting to the Associate Director, the Grant Writer is responsible for developing and writing grant proposals, researching potential funding sources and formally seeking funding on behalf of the University. 

Grant Writer:

 • Assemble grant applications, including support letters, proposals, budgets, assurances and certifications, etc. for submissions.
• Communicate with sponsors to check the progression of applications and provide reports to the Associate Director for the Office of Sponsored Programs and Research. 
• Work closely and collaboratively with faculty, staff, and administrators in providing valuable pre-award services.
• Writes, edits, and proofreads text of contracts and grants including reorganizing content for better flow, rewording for clarity, and editing to comply with APA or other style guidelines. 
• Keep accurate records to track proposals.
• Maintain calendar to ensure timely submission of letters of inquiry, proposal deadlines, and reports.
 • Prioritize projects to keep multiple projects moving in a timely manner, meet deadlines, and assist with the management of multiple proposals.
 • Coordinate all grant submissions with Authorized Organizational Representatives (AORs)
